validate:
description:
- The validation command to run before copying the updated file into the final destination.
- A temporary file path is used to validate, passed in through '%s' which must be present as in the examples below.
- Also, the command is passed securely so shell features such as expansion and pipes will not work.
- For an example on how to handle more complex validation than what this
option provides, see R(handling complex validation,complex_configuration_validation).
type: str
